This research was setting by the lack of fine motor skills of children. This was because the children’s fine motor development when playing is still not effective, in this research use the constructive play method using clay media to improve children’s fine motor skills. Therefore, this research aims to determine the effect of constructive play with clay media to the fine motor skills of children aged 5-6 years in North Maria Village, Wawo District, Bima Regency in 2020. This research was conducted during of Covid-19 pandemic while still paying attention to health protocol. The population and sample consisted of 8 children who were divided into 4 children in the control group and 4 children in the experimental group. Based on the normality and homogeneous assumption testing, the normality test on the difference between the pretest and posttest with a significance level of 0.087 (p> 0.05) the research data spread normally and met the normality assumption. Homogeneous testing in this research using Levene Test, which obtained a test statistic value of 1.370 with a significance value of 0.261, then the fine motor skills of children met the assumption of homogeneity. Hypothesis testing using Paired T Different Test with a T test value of 100.625 with a significance value of <0.001. The significance value is less than the 5% significance level, indicating that the initial hypothesis (H0) was rejected. It can be concluded that there was an influence of the constructive play method with clay media on the fine motor skills of children aged 5-6 years in North Maria Village, Wawo District, Bima Regency, in 2020.
